The Fiberlink® 3353 Series receives SMPTE standard 3G, HD or SD-SDI signals transmitted from the Fiberlink® 3350, Fiberlink® 3360, or Fiberlink® 3380 Series transmitters, with or without embedded audio, and converts the baseband output to DVI. The Fiberlink® 3353 receiver provides an independent audio output providing you with the ability to separate your audio and video signals. The audio is also embedded into the HDMI cable. The Fiberlink® 3553 operates with both single mode and multimode fiber and can be configured with an ST connector or an LC connector Optional features include an equalized and re-clocked SDI output All Fiberlink® 3G/HD/SD-SDI products are compliant with SMPTE 297-2006 and has the ability to operate seamlessly with Fiberlink® Matrix and other SMPTE 297-2006 fiber optic compliant devices. All Fiberlink® 3G/HD/SD-SDI products are immune to pathological signals over the entire budget link and operating temperature range and operate with both single mode and multimode fiber types. Fiberlink® Matrix is a fully configurable and SMPTE compliant 32x32 optical router. The inputs and outputs can be ordered in quantities of one and the input and output quantities do not have to match providing you with the ability to build a Matrix that is ideal for your specific application and budget!
